Marshallese[edit]

Etymology[edit]

Borrowed from German Atlantik, borrowed from Latin ātlanticus.

Pronunciation[edit]

  • (phonetic) IPA(key): [ɑdˠ(ʌ)lˠɑndˠiːk], (enunciated) [ɑtˠ lˠɑnˠ tˠiik]
  • (phonemic) IPA(key): /ɰætˠlˠænˠtˠijik/
  • Bender phonemes: {hatļaņtiyik}

Proper noun[edit]

Atļaņtiik (M.O.D.: Atḷaṇtiik)

  1. the Atlantic; the Atlantic Ocean
